I am a BNO (British National Overseas) passport holder. Moved to UK with my dutch husband on Jan 05. I already send my passport to Home Office for Permanent Residence. I was just wondering can I apply for naturalisation right away without waiting for the 12 month periods?

No, you need to have permanent residence for a year before applying. (If your husband were a British citizen you would not need this, but he is Dutch, so the concenssions to spouses of British citizens do not apply.)

Can you suggest what is the best way to get the British Citizen?
As I am a BNO passport holder, I can register as a British Citizen after 6 year, I don't need to do the life in UK test and the fee is cheaper or I should go through the EEA family member way, PR + Naturalisation? Do you think there is any difference??

Best option is probably to apply for Registration as a British citizen after 1 year of PR (with at least 5 years legal residence); in other words, in January 2011.

Are you a Chinese citizen? If not, you may be able to register now as a British citizen by descent.
